Salary: Market relatedReference: 014/03/22Senior SharePoint and Microsoft Power DeveloperAltrinchamHybrid Working - 3 days Working from Home 2 Days OfficeAbout UsCity & County Healthcare Group is a family of care companies delivering domiciliary care, extra care, complex care and live-in care services across the UK. As an industry leader, were bound by a common set of values and principles in providing flexible,community-based care support of the highest standard that actively promotes the independence, dignity and choice for our clients and customers while promoting staff support and development.The RoleWere currently looking for a passionate and dedicated Senior SharePoint Developer with strong experience in Microsoft Power Apps to join us on a full-time basis. The role is hybrid working, 70-75% at home and 25-30% travelling to our office locations acrossthe UK including London and Altrincham.This is a new role and an exciting time to join us as we develop the companys full SharePoint and Microsoft Power App estate. The role will deliver meaningful value using the Microsoft tech stack while designing efficient applications, workflow and datasharing across the platform.In addition to bringing your technical skills, you will also have excellent communication and key stakeholder management skills to enable great working relationships with members of the operational teams, branch staff and functional heads of departmentsto deliver change and project objectives.Duties & ResponsibilitiesIncluding, but not limited to:
